Hey Kittie, <p> I really liked Acchi Kocchi from last season. It's comedy/romance and, IMHO does both extremely well. The one (possible) downside is that it's based on a yonkoma, so there isn't a lot of overall progression though the series. You'll probably be able to tell whether or not you'll like it from the first episode. <p> I also liked <a href="http://www.crunchyroll.com/inu-x-boku-secret-service">Inu X Boku</a>. The setup and mood reminded me a bit of "Fruits Basket". I liked both the comedy and romance in this one too, but there's also some psychological depth to the characters that comes out in the latter episodes. <p> I see you already have Kimi ni Todoke in your anime list, so I won't bother suggesting it :). Though if you haven't seen the live-action adaptation yet I'd say it's worth it. They rush through two seasons of material really quickly, but for the most part the casting is pretty amazingly spot-on. <p> For pure comedy I usually get a few solid laughs from each episode of <a href="http://www.crunchyroll.com/polar-bear-cafe">Shirokuma Cafe</a>, though the humor is pretty dry and might not be your thing. Also, I thought the first few episodes were a little weak, but it picked up. <p>
